[QUOTE="rpf500, post: 675316, member: 6870"] If I pull the fuse and let it sit 5 minutes, all modes of 4wd and auto 4wd function. Last time it went about a week before throwing dash indicator. Before that maybe 2 or 4 days. So I'm assuming that motor and actuator are both fine since they function. I read about modules failing internally over time which made sense to me given the symptoms. Basically it's about $75 for a used and the potential fee from GM to reset it possibly. Or around $150 aftermarket, no programming needed. I think I just talked myself in to using aftermarket as I typed this. My time and hassle is worth the $75 extra. [/QUOTE]
